Analysis

Haiti recorded 23 for vitamin a supplementation, semester 1 coverage in 2021.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 27.8% on the previous year and down 36.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, vitamin a supplementation, semester 1 coverage in Haiti peaked at 74 in 2005 and was at its lowest, 0, in 2003.

That places Haiti 49th out of 63 countries with data for 2021,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
